Output f890c6dddfa32bf383a43cf1238160702e780a6dcdd4c8320d29f5390941e05a:2

value
19792206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 824f0a969fbb10af99308f224ee1b567813102d5 OP_EQUAL
address
MKnAmFvkJPhYXWiDsRkbLEocCsnhxfWMvF
transaction
f890c6dddfa32bf383a43cf1238160702e780a6dcdd4c8320d29f5390941e05a
spent
true